Guys and Dolls premiered on Broadway in 1950 and was subsequently revived in 1976, 1992, and, most recently, in 2009. With music and lyrics by Frank Loesser, and book by Jo Swerling and Abe Burrows, Guys and Dolls has remained a perennial favorite in the American musical theater canon. Along the horizontal line is the range of wavelengths that correspond to visible light, and which is nearly the same as that used by plants for photosynthesis. That is why leaves appear green, because light reflected from leaf to your eye is enriched in the green wavelengths relative to the blue or red.

When this bright light hits the leaf, it causes an imbalance between energy capture (the conversion of light energy into chemical energy) and energy utilization (the making of sugars in photosynthesis). Trees whose leaves fall down in autumn are called deciduous. Chlorophyll is green because of the way it absorbs light; the pigment absorbs the blue and yellow wavelengths but not the green.
